Management Commentary

During the post-earnings public call, Mercury General Corporation leadership shared insights into the key drivers of the the previous quarter results. Management noted that operational efficiency gains, including the recent rollout of AI-powered digital claims processing tools, helped reduce administrative costs and speed up claims resolution times during the quarter, supporting overall profitability. Leaders also highlighted that milder-than-expected catastrophic weather activity in many of MCY’s high-population operating regions contributed to lower-than-projected catastrophe-related claims payouts for the period. At the same time, management acknowledged that persistent inflationary pressures on auto repair costs, medical care expenses, and skilled labor remain ongoing industry headwinds, noting that the firm has implemented targeted rate adjustments in 17 operating states over recent months to align pricing with evolving risk profiles. All commentary shared aligned with formal filing disclosures, with no unscripted off-topic remarks shared during the call. Forward Guidance

For upcoming operating periods, MCY’s leadership shared cautious forward guidance aligned with the firm’s historical public reporting practices. Management noted that they would likely continue investing in upgrades to their underwriting risk modeling systems and customer-facing digital platforms, with the goal of improving long-term operating efficiency and customer retention. Leaders also stated that they may pursue limited geographic expansion in states with favorable regulatory frameworks and risk dynamics, though no specific market entry timelines or targets were shared. Management also flagged potential headwinds that could impact future performance, including a possible rise in severe catastrophic weather events across U.S. regions, sustained inflation in claims-related costs, and shifts in state insurance regulatory requirements. The firm noted that it is maintaining a higher capital reserve buffer to help mitigate potential unforeseen losses from these identified risks. Market Reaction

Market response to the MCY the previous quarter earnings release has been mixed in recent trading sessions, per public market data. Shares of Mercury General Corporation traded with above-average volume in the sessions following the release, as investors adjusted their positions to reflect the new operational data. Sell-side analysts covering the firm have published a range of reactions: some have pointed to the stronger underwriting margin performance as a positive signal of the firm’s ability to navigate ongoing industry headwinds, while others have raised questions about the sustainability of lower catastrophe claims payouts in future periods. Options market data shows moderately elevated implied volatility for MCY shares in the near term, suggesting that market participants are pricing in potential price swings as further analysis of the quarterly results is published. The results also align with broader trends across the P&C insurance sector, where many peers have reported similar balances between operational efficiency gains and inflation-related cost pressures in recent earnings prints.
